Getting Started: How to Become a Volunteer
YMCA VolunteersBecoming a YMCA volunteer is a fun and rewarding experience. Get started today by following these five easy steps:
  1. Discover how you want to help
    Find the opportunity that’s right for you by looking through our Volunteer Opportunities.
  2. Complete the application form
    Download the Volunteer Application  and drop it off in person at your choice of YMCA location.
  3. Come in for an interview
    Once your information is received by the centre and a suitable opportunity becomes available, a volunteer coordinator will contact you to set up an interview. At the interview you will learn more about the volunteer position and how you can help the YMCA.
  4. Submit a current Police Records Check
    Most volunteers will be required to submit a current Police Records Check (current within 6 months) before they begin their volunteer service. Contact your local police station for more information.
  5. Start making a difference!
    Once you have successfully completed the first four steps, you will be scheduled to start volunteering. An orientation to your role and a staff member will be assigned to answer your questions.
